Mornig Reports 6:@20 & 7:*20 Weather ,Sports end News THE OSHAWA 1350 STATION The following are the latest resuits of Durham Interdistriet soccer play: JUNIOR June 26 at Peel Park, Ferrco -Engineering of Whitby shut out Brooklin 2-0 with goals by John Longmuir and Dave Wilcox. Ferrco recorded its fifth win in six starts and remains in a tic with the Oshawa Falcons for top spot in the league. Earl Hand did a fine job in goal for - WHitby, coming up with some good saves. Ferrco will be home to West Shore on July 10 at 8 p.m. and then will play Ajax JuIy 17 in Ajax at 7 p.m. PEE WEE June 27 at Peel Park Longmuir Builders shut out Cobourg by an astounding 10-0 score, Goals were scored by Tom Seheeffer, Robert Longmuir, Fred D'Andrea, Carmel Scaffidi, Ed Svetek and John Schell. Goalten der Bobby Sherman got the shutout in a game which was called approx- imately 15 minutes early at the request of the Cobourg coach. Longmuir Builders are still unbeaten in league play and remain in top spot tied with Oshawa Rangers. BANTAM June 28 at Ajax, Carretto Restaurant and Tavern of Whitby shut out Ajax 4-0 with 9oals. by George Rossier. Warren Subject and Richard Greaves who netted two. Goalie Mike Kio'ke got the shutout, to avenge a defeat by Ajax earli-pr in the season. Carretto's next game is tonight at Peel Park at 8 p.nI. against Oshawa, Socc er resuits in Ontarjo Cup The following- are the results of the Ontario Cup Soccer Tournament in which a number of Whitby teams participated. JUNIOR June 25 at Humbergorve Collegiate in Rexdale, Fei rco Engineering of Whitby defeated the Rexdale Royals 4-1 with goals by Ken Beattie, Garvin Clarke, Keith Wilson, (penalty kick) and Kerry Lang, Ferrco got bye through the preliminary round and Rexdalc won 5-1 in its pre- liminary round. Whitby, apart from a short lapse at" the start of the second haîf, were in com- plete control of the gameý. PEE WEE June 24 at Peel Park, the Whitby Longmuir Builders edged Guildwood 3-2 with goals by Robert Longmuir, Fred D'Andrea and Ed Svetek. It was a good even garne with Whitby taking an -early 2-0 lead and Guildwood fight- ing back to tic things ulp before haif time. It was a real end-to-end battle in the second haif with the victor in doubt until Ed Svetek headed in the winner 10 minutes from the final Whistle. BANTAM In a close game, June 24 at Peel Park, Downsview defeated. Carretto Rest- aurant and Tavern of Whitby 2-1 and eliminated them from the tournament. Warren Subject got the only Whitby goal. Wintario grants set Two Whitby organizations will be receiving Wintario grants this month. The Whitby Public Library wilI receive a grant of $7,750- to assist with the purchase of banners and graphics for their recently renovated building, A grant of $7,650 will be used by the Whitby Corne Sail Junior Program to aid in the purchase of sailing equipment.
